Having a consistent tropical rainforest climate, the country of Singapore welcomes people from all the regions of the world throughout the year. Nevertheless, when talking about the most ideal time to visit the country, then it is usually considered to be the months of February, March, and April. It is because the country has a pleasant weather during this time of the year and therefore people love exploring the various tourist sites of the country.

If you want to experience the festive vibes in this island city state, then plan your visit either in the months of January and February or during October. If you visit in January or February, you’ll be able to attend the fun and vibrant Chinese New Year celebrations where you’ll get to witness the various mesmerising fireworks. In the month of October, however, you can attend mid-autumn festivals.

2. Going For Water Sports

water

Image Credit: Pixabay

Kallang has got a plenty of options for you when it comes to playing water sports. If you are an adult, head over to the water venture and indulge yourselves into various water sports activities like kayaking, windsurfing, sailing, and dragon-boating or sea rafting. You can even take a one-day course on kayaking for just $25.
Or if you are someone who wants their kids to enjoy the same, then take them to Kallang mall where the children aged between 3 to 12 can enjoy splashing and surfing in the water at a special area provided. 3. Katong Food Walk

Food Walk

Every Thursday, a 4 hour walking tour is conducted by the Betel Box hostel owners which you can join to taste over 30 dishes of traditional cuisines like fish head curry, chilli crab, dimsum etc. The tour also offers all the aspects about the lifestyle and culture of the history of the local population belonging to the area. The guide imparts interesting trivias about Singapore and especially about the Geylang area. You will have the time of your life traveling through the colourful loronges and satisfying the food buff in you which makes this tour an absolute necessary thing to do in Geylang at night.

Location: Starts from Betel Box Hostel
Timings: 6:30pm to 10:30pm
Average Cost: INR 5000 per person

4. Artspace Museum

ArtSpace

Image Source

ArtSpace Museum, which is located at the Prestige Istana Park, redefines art and lifestyles. Being a leading art club for all, anyone from anywhere can learn, enjoy and appreciate art here. It can be reached easily as it is just a 5-minutes walk away from the Dhoby Ghaut MRT. It offers flexible timing and personalized painting and drawing workshops for the art lovers to explore, learn from and enjoy.
